Indian Springs Elementary School vs CLINTONVILLE ACADEMY

Indian Springs Elementary School and CLINTONVILLE ACADEMY are very closely rated, both scoring around 7.9 out of 10. Indian Springs Elementary School is significantly larger with 360 students, about 3.4× the size of CLINTONVILLE ACADEMY (105). In math proficiency, Indian Springs Elementary School leads at 87.0%.
